Output edb67fe2d7b9da95b35d2e9f02b8ae83693e89c4c8e59d630e87d2ee760ae8d3:1

value
128481489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e4793ca244ba0aebdfcba4fe10b39d8dfeb511 OP_EQUAL
address
3CSNgcNVMTeiVEMHcmu5E7Vuow4aMCtM9f
transaction
edb67fe2d7b9da95b35d2e9f02b8ae83693e89c4c8e59d630e87d2ee760ae8d3
confirmations
298173
spent
true